Introduction to Multi-Probe Labs

Test Object: OTA testing of small and medium-sized wireless terminals and modules such as cell phones, smart watches, tablets, laptops, Bluetooth headsets, routers, GPS antennas, WiFi antennas, small drones, smart door locks, etc.


System Specifications

ItemSpecification
Anechoic Chamber Dimensions (W×D×H)3000×3000×3000 mm
Absorber Size500×500×300 mm
Door Opening Dimensions1000×2000 mm
Total Mass3100 kg
Number of Probes in Circular Array23+1
Array Ring Diameter1500 mm
Sampling Interval15°
DUT Weight Limit≤25 kg


Test Capabilities

Passive Testing

ItemSpecification
Supported Frequency Range600 MHz – 8 GHz
Supported PolarizationLinear Polarization, Circular Polarization, Elliptical Polarization
Test ItemsGain, Efficiency, 2D Radiation Pattern, 3D Radiation Pattern, Roundness, Axial Ratio, etc.
Test FeaturesUltra-fast testing, supporting all antenna parameters for passive and active GPS antennas; using ultra-fast near-field to far-field transformation algorithm, with far-field data at 1° intervals as results.


Active Testing

ItemSpecification
Supported Frequency Range600 MHz – 8 GHz
Test IndicatorsTotal Radiated Power (TRP), Total Isotropic Sensitivity (TIS), Effective Isotropic Radiated Power (EIRP), Effective Isotropic Sensitivity (EIS) for complete devices;
Test Modes2G/3G/4G/5G, Wi-Fi b/g/n/a/ac/ax, Bluetooth, NB-IoT, Cat-M (eMTC), GPS/BEIDOU/GLONASS, ZigBee, LoRa (non-signaling);
Test FeaturesEditable, callable, savable test tasks, multiple highly efficient TIS test methods;
